What Even IS a .undf File? (And Why Should I Care?)

Okay, let’s be honest. .undf isn't exactly a household name. It's often a placeholder or a partially downloaded file. Sometimes it's a file whose actual format the system can't identify. Basically, it's the video equivalent of a "mystery meat" lunch special. The point is, you can't play it easily, and that's where we step in.

Why .mp4, you ask? Because it's the king of video formats! Most devices, from your phone to your smart TV, will happily gobble up an .mp4 file. It’s the Swiss Army knife of video compatibility. Think of it as giving your video a passport to travel the world!

Level Up: Using Dedicated Video Conversion Software (For Larger Files & More Control)

For those of you with larger .undf files, or if you want more control over the conversion process, dedicated video conversion software is the way to go. Think of it as upgrading from a scooter to a sports car.

Popular options include Handbrake (free and open-source!), Any Video Converter (has a free version), and Movavi Video Converter (paid, but often comes with a free trial). These programs offer a wealth of options, allowing you to customize the video resolution, bitrate, frame rate, and more.

Troubleshooting: When Things Go Wrong (Because They Always Do!)

Sometimes, even with the best tools, things can go sideways. If your conversion fails or the resulting .mp4 file is corrupted, here are a few things to try:

  • Make sure your .undf file isn't actually a completely broken or incomplete download. Try downloading it again.
  • Try a different converter. Sometimes, one converter just doesn't play nice with a particular file.
  • Update your video conversion software to the latest version.
  • Check your computer's storage space. You need enough free space to store the converted file.
  • As a last resort, try renaming the file extension to .mp4. Sometimes, the file IS already in mp4 format, but the extension is incorrect. It’s a long shot, but worth a try!
